Benefits of VoIP Phone Systems
Voice over Internet Protocol phone systems provide meaningful cost benefits for little businesses by reducing traditional phone line expenses. With VoIP, businesses can utilize their existing internet connection, eliminating the need for dedicated telephone lines. This shift leads to reduced monthly bills and diminished infrastructure costs, making it an alluring option for cost-sensitive companies. Additionally, many VoIP providers offer flexible pricing plans that allow businesses to pay merely for the services they need.
Another plus of VoIP telephone systems is their enhanced functionality compared to standard phone systems. VoIP solutions often come with a set of advanced features such as voicemail to email integration, video conferencing, and call forwarding. These features can boost communication efficiency and enhance collaboration among team members, no matter their location. Petite businesses can take advantage from these tools without the need for pricey hardware upgrades or additional software.

Determining a Suitable VoIP System
When selecting a VoIP phone system, it is important to assess your specific needs of your small business. Consider factors such as number of employees, essential features, and the types of communications most frequently made. Understanding how VoIP can enhance communication inside the team and with clients will help one make a well-informed decision. Capabilities such as call forwarding, voicemail to email, and conference calling can enhance productivity and enhance customer service.
Another critical aspect to consider is the scalability of the VoIP telephone service. As your business expands, your communication requirements will evolve. Select a provider that allows for simple upgrades and additional lines without facing significant costs. This flexibility ensures that you won’t be restricted by your phone system as you expand, letting you to adapt to changing circumstances and requirements.
Lastly, cost is a significant factor in selecting a VoIP solution. Look at different VoIP phone systems to assess their cost structures, which include installation fees and ongoing monthly costs. Seek out plans that offer essential features without unnecessary extras. A thorough cost analysis will guarantee that you find a reliable VoIP telephone service that matches your budget and provides optimal value for your small business requirements.
